Explain the difference between mass and weight for objects on earth and on the moon

Mass and weight, while similar are not the same.  Mass is the amount of matter in an object.  This remains the same both on earth and the moon.  Weight is the impact gravity has on an object.  This would be lighter on the moon, and heavier on the earth.
